Fish
Salmon Fillets 0.50 - 4.00 lb
(225 g - 1.8 kg)
Wire rack -
facing up
2 - 3 min Suitable for salmon fillets 2 inches or
less. Tuck under thin ends. Place
salmon skin side down in a dish
(i.e. Earthenware) on the wire rack.
Tuna Steak 0.50 - 2.00 lb
(225 - 900 g)
Wire rack -
facing down
2 - 3 min Suitable for tuna steaks 2 inches or
less. Flip steaks at the beep. Place
steaks in a dish (i.e. Earthenware) on
the wire rack.
Whole Fish 0.75 - 2.00 lb
(340 - 900 g)
Wire rack -
facing down
2 - 3 min Before cooking, remove guts and fins
from fish. Turn over at the beep. Place
fish in a dish (i.e. Earthenware) on the
wire rack.
Halibut Fillets 0.75 - 2.00 lb
(340 - 900 g)
Wire rack -
facing down
2 - 3 min Suitable for halibut fillets 2 inches or
less. Place halibut skin side down in a
dish (i.e. Earthenware) on the wire
rack.
